Solution and Explanation

Workarounds are interim measures to restore services rapidly and ensure business continuity during the development of a permanent resolution. They do not address the underlying issue but mitigate disruption. Alternative explanations:
  • Maintenance involves scheduled tasks to ensure system operational efficiency.
  • Known error correction entails rectifying errors subsequent to root cause identification.
  • Temporary servicing is an uncommon designation in this domain.
